Abstract
Aerogels of different densities were prepared from silica gels by supe rcritical drying in a high temperature and high pressure plant. Gels w ere synthesised front tetramethoxysilane (TMOS) using acetone or metha nol as solvents. For the acetone gels, several volume ratios of precur sor and solvent were used. Properties of the obtained aerogels were an alysed and their pore structure was studied by gas/vapour adsorption a nd scanning electron microscopy (SEM). Changing the volume ratio of pr ecursor and solvent reveals itself as an easy way to modify the densit y, porosity and mechanical strength of the acetone aerogels. (C) 1998 Elsevier Science Limited.
